#include <linux/time.h>
#include "qman_private.h"
#include "bman_private.h"
__init void qman_init_early(void);
__init void bman_init_early(void);
static __init int qbman_init(void)
{
struct device_node *dn;
u32 is_portal_available;
bman_init();
qman_init();
is_portal_available = 0;
for_each_compatible_node(dn, NULL, "fsl,qman-portal") {
if (!of_device_is_available(dn))
continue;
else
is_portal_available = 1;
}
if (!qman_have_ccsr() && is_portal_available) {
struct qman_fq fq = {
.fqid = 1
};
struct qm_mcr_queryfq_np np;
int err, retry = CONFIG_FSL_QMAN_INIT_TIMEOUT;
struct timespec64 nowts, diffts, startts;
ktime_get_coarse_real_ts64(&startts);
/* Loop while querying given fqid succeeds or time out */
while (1) {
err = qman_query_fq_np(&fq, &np);
if (!err) {
/* success, control-plane has configured QMan */
break;
} else if (err != -ERANGE) {
pr_err("QMan: I/O error, continuing anyway\n");
break;
}
ktime_get_coarse_real_ts64(&nowts);
diffts = timespec64_sub(nowts, startts);
if (diffts.tv_sec > 0) {
if (!retry--) {
pr_err("QMan: time out, control-plane"
" dead?\n");
break;
}
pr_warn("QMan: polling for the control-plane"
" (%d)\n", retry);
}
}
}
bman_resource_init();
qman_resource_init();
return 0;
}
subsys_initcall(qbman_init);
